Origin |
Despite its name, the Australian Shepherd is not actually from Australia. They originated in the United States.
|
Size |
20 to 23 inches (51 to 58 cm) tall at the shoulder, while females are slightly smaller, ranging from 18 to 21 inches (46 to 53 cm). |
Breed Group |
Herding Group |
Lifespan |
12 to 15 years
|
Coat |
They have a double coat that is of medium length and can be either straight or wavy. The coat comes in various colors, including black, blue merle, red, and red merle, often with white markings and copper points. |
Temperament |
Australian Shepherds are highly intelligent, energetic, and versatile dogs. They have a strong work ethic, and are loyal and affection towards their families. They are reserved with strangers but are generally friendly and social once they warm up.
|
Exercise needs |
This breed is very active and requires regular exercise to keep them both physically and mentally stimulated. Daily walks, playtime, and interactive activities are essential to prevent boredom and ensure their well-being.
|
Training |
Australian Shepherds are quick learners and excel in various dog sports and activities. Early socialization and consistent, positive reinforcement-based training are crucial for their well-rounded development.
|
Grooming |
Their coat requires regular brushing to prevent matting and keep it looking its best.
|
Health |
Australian Shepherds are generally a healthy breed, but like all breeds, they can be prone to certain genetic health issues. Common concerns include hip dysplasia, eye disorders, and epilepsy. Regular veterinary check-ups and a healthy lifestyle can help mitigate these risks.

Australian Shepherd Price in India
It's no secret that the Australian Shepherd (Aussie), with stunning eyes, endless energy, and a playful spirit, has won hearts worldwide. If you're thinking of welcoming this multi-faceted dog to the comfort of your Indian house, then you'll have to think about the costs of bringing this trusted animal into your home. Australian Shepherd Price in India based on below factors.
Factors Affecting the Price Tag:
- Breeder: A reputable breeder committed to ethical standards, health tests, and socialization to a high standard naturally charges higher prices than unregistered breeders or backyard breeders. Australian Shepherd Price in India from reliable breeders between Rs60,000 and Rs1,00,000 or more.
- Pedigree line Australian Shepherd Price in India: A puppy with exceptional lineage or champion bloodlines could fetch significantly more money, reaching at least Rs100,000.
- Gender: Male Aussies may be a bit more expensive than females.
- Place: Prices may vary according to your city or region. The cities generally have higher costs than rural areas.
- Age: Adult Aussies or older puppies are often cheaper than puppies just starting.
- Demand: Australia is becoming more popular in India; however, this can increase prices due to high demand and limited availability.
